Berberis hobsonii
What's the taxonomical classification of Berberis hobsonii?
Berberis hobsonii belongs to the kingdom Plantae and is classified under the phylum Streptophyta. Within this group, it is categorized under the class Equisetopsida and the subclass Magnoliidae. Following the taxonomic hierarchy further, it falls under the order Ranunculales and is a member of the family Berberidaceae. Finally, the plant is identified by its genus, Berberis, and its specific species name, hobsonii.

What are the morphological characteristics of this plant?
Berberis hobsonii has small, leathery, oval-shaped leaves that are typically dark green and arranged alternately along its woody, spine-tipped stems. The plant grows as a dense, low-spreading shrub characterized by its compact and spreading habit. Its stems are armed with sharp, woody spines that serve as a primary defensive feature. During the flowering season, small, inconspicuous flowers emerge from the leaf axils. The shrub eventually produces small, dark berries that follow the floral display.
What is the geographical distribution of this plant?
This plant is native to the high-altitude regions of the Himalayas, specifically distributed across parts of northern India, Nepal, Bhutan, and southwestern China. It thrives in subalpine zones where it can find suitable rocky or scrubby terrain. Its range is largely dictated by the specific cool and moist climates found within these mountainous ecosystems. Local populations are often found at elevations ranging from 2,500 to 4,000 meters above sea level. This specialized habitat restricts its natural occurrence to these specific longitudinal corridors in Central and South Asia.

What are the pharmacological activities of Berberis hobsonii?
This plant has potent antimicrobial, antioxidant, anti-inflammatory, and antidiabetic pharmacological activities driven by its high concentration of bioactive alkaloids. Research indicates that the presence of berberine and other isoquinoline alkaloids allows the species to inhibit the growth of various pathogenic bacteria and fungi. Furthermore, the plant demonstrates significant scavenging capabilities against free radicals, which helps reduce oxidative stress in biological systems. Studies also suggest that extracts from the plant can regulate blood glucose levels and modulate inflammatory responses through specific molecular pathways. These diverse biochemical properties make it a subject of interest for developing new therapeutic agents.
What medicinal compounds this plant contains?
This plant contains high concentrations of isoquinoline alkaloids, specifically berberine, palmatine, jatrorrhizine, and coptisine. These specific chemical compounds are primarily localized within the roots and rhizomes of the species. Berberine serves as the most prominent bioactive agent, known for its significant antimicrobial and anti-inflammatory properties. Researchers often study these alkaloids for their potential to regulate metabolic processes and combat oxidative stress. The synergistic interaction between these various medicinal alkaloids provides the plant with its diverse therapeutic profile.
